Networking
families of children with cancer was how Kids Cancer Crusade began and
it continues to be a very important part of what we do. Part of the
application process is giving us permission to add the child's website
and basic information to our website. Understanding each family's desire for privacy, it
is NOT required to have the child's
information posted on our website network to participate in our other
programs. We may, however, ask a family to email with another family if
their situations are helpful to each other. Families may also ONLY
participate by adding their information to our network as a resource
for other families and opt out of our other programs such as care
packages. It is our hope that as our network grows, families
are able to connect with other families to share experiences. Those
dealing with a new diagnosis or relapse find it especially helpful.

Care Packages
Encouraging, honoring & remembering our Heroes.
*Angel* Christi T.
continously brought smiles to the faces of other children with cancer
by keeping them company, bringing them things to do and brightening up
their rooms with decorations all while receiving treatment herself. She
loved to help other kids like her and spend time with her family and
friends. Keeping in line with her actions, our care packages began...
New Families
The purpose of this package is to welcome you and encourage your family
to spend some quality time together. In addition, gift cards are
included for the parents while pajamas, hats and other comfort items
are included for the child receiving treatment.
Relapse
To let you know we're still here and pulling for your family, you'll
receive another package similar to the one for new families.
End of Treatment
*Angel* Tyler H.
loved a good party and decorated everything to perfection. In true
Ty-Guy style, this care package is sure to bring a smile and a lot of
celebration! We're keeping the details a secret though - it's a
surprise! A huge thank you to The Party Starts Here in Fremont, Ohio for their generosity.
*Please help us keep track of this as treatment schedules change. If
you knew when you applied when the child would be completing treatment
we will go with that, but many are unsure. Please send an email about a
month ahead of time.*
Angel Families
We will donate a copy of the child's favorite book to their local library or
school in their memory. In addition, an item acknowledging the child's
fight
and memory will be sent to the family. *Imprint on my Heart, LLC has generously donated fingerprint impression kits which are available upon request.
Transplant
Packages of lots of fun things to do are
mailed when a child is heading to to transplant or another particularly
long hospital stay. Comfy pajamas are included - please provide your
child's clothing size. These packages must be requested.
Hats
Many comfy and cute hats have been donated just for the kids that have
lost their hair due to chemotherapy. Knitted hats are available during
the winter season and other hats are available any time. These must be
requested.

Volunteer Photography
Capturing memories & milestones.
ALL of our families are welcome to a session with one of our volunteer
photographers regardless of the child's treatment status. Details will
vary with each
photographer but we will work together to find the perfect match for
you! Our current partners are listed below - if you know of another
photographer than may be interested in joining our team or you are in
need of a photographer in a different area, please let us know.
It is also important that you go through Kids Cancer Crusade to
schedule your session or your family may not receive the session for
free.
